Maximize transfer credit, minimize time and cost
The RN to BSN program offers the opportunity to transfer substantial credit earned from prior college coursework for those who are eligible.
You can potentially transfer up to 20 approved credits from prior college coursework into the RN to BSN program. This represents 75% of the total program semester credits (120), the time needed to complete the program, and cost of tuition.
There are two levels of transfer credit which comprise the total number:
- Block transfer from your degree/diploma. You can block transfer up to 70 credits from your current associate degree or diploma in nursing. The total number depends on how much credit you earned in the program.
- Additional credit from gen eds or electives. You may be able to transfer credit earned from certain types of general education or elective courses. This is how you can potentially bridge the gap from your block transfer credit total to 90.
